With one in five Australians identifying as Catholic according to latest census data, the news of Pope Francis' death aged 88 will be felt in all corners of the nation today. For one of the country's most senior Catholics, Archbishop Timothy Costelloe, Pope Francis will be remembered as a man of "simplicity, humility and compassion."
